If you never touched the FSX.cfg that means that your autogen is still at default 4000 trees and 4000 (or 4500?) buildings per cell. If we can see only such few objects on your terrain, then that means two possible things:
- as I said before, this terrain has textures including few autogen spots
- you're zooming on distant terrain, and distant terrain always has fewer autogen objects.

Try flying around a real forest, set the external view zoom to 0.80 or 0.70. Autogen should be more dense.
